POLICE say parents of youths acting in an anti-social manner were ‘devastated’ after finding out.
Plain clothed officers from Cheshire Police caught the children throwing bricks at a house on Wellingford Avenue in Halebank yesterday, Tuesday.
Officers say the youngsters also kicked the front door and antagonised the owner’s dog.
Those responsible have been dealt with by way of a community resolution
The force’s Ditton and Hale Police team said: “An address on Wellingford Avenue in Halebank was being targeted by youths.
“They were throwing stones and bricks at the address over a number of days and had been kicking the front door and seemingly antagonising the occupant’s dog.
“Plain clothed police officers caught the youths at the location last night and took them home to their parents, who were devastated.
“The youths will be dealt with by way of a community resolution.”
